The E-cores should enhance longevity slightly. 13600K continues to rise, regardless of being a K on a locked board. 13700 offers 8P cores ideal for gaming and ample E-core capacity for background work. According to 14th gen rumors, E-cores are being integrated throughout the entire stack.

RTX 4080 handles 2K at 144hz effortlessly, and the 4070 keeps up well above 60 FPS. The 4070Ti sits in the middle, offering solid performance over 100 FPS at 1440p. At higher settings, the 3080Ti behaves similarly to an RTX4070 in rasterization, with no game meeting acceptable results at 1440p.
